Understanding Roll Up Garage Doors
Roll-up garage doors, also known as coiling doors, are a popular choice for both residential and commercial properties. They offer several advantages, including space-saving design, durability, and security. Unlike sectional doors that slide up and overhead, roll-up doors coil vertically into a compact roll above the opening. This makes them ideal for garages with limited headroom or those requiring maximum clearance.
Is DIY Roll Up Door Installation Right for You
Before diving into the installation process, it’s crucial to assess your skills and resources. Installing a roll-up garage door involves working with heavy components, electrical wiring (if motorized), and specialized tools. It requires a good understanding of mechanical systems and the ability to follow detailed instructions precisely. If you’re not comfortable with these tasks, it’s best to leave the installation to professionals. Improper installation can lead to serious injuries and costly repairs down the line.
Essential Tools and Materials
If you decide to proceed with DIY installation, gather the necessary tools and materials. This list may vary depending on the specific model of your roll-up door, so always refer to the manufacturer’s instructions. Generally, you’ll need:
- Roll-up garage door kit (including curtain, tracks, springs, and hardware)
- Level
- Tape measure
- Drill with various drill bits
- Wrenches and sockets
- Screwdrivers
- Hammer
- Safety glasses
- Gloves
- Ladder
- Lifting equipment (e.g., chain hoist)
- Electrical wiring and connectors (if motorized)
Step-by-Step Installation Guide
While the specific steps may vary depending on the door model, here’s a general overview of the roll-up garage door installation process:
Step 1 Prepare the Opening
Ensure the garage door opening is properly framed and level. Remove any existing door, hardware, and debris. Check for any structural issues and address them before proceeding.
Step 2 Install the Tracks
Attach the vertical tracks to the sides of the opening, ensuring they are plumb and aligned. Use shims if necessary to achieve a perfectly level installation. Secure the tracks with screws or bolts, following the manufacturer’s instructions.
Step 3 Assemble the Curtain
The curtain is the main body of the roll-up door. Assemble the individual slats or panels according to the manufacturer’s instructions. This may involve interlocking the sections or attaching them with hinges.
Step 4 Mount the Spring Assembly
The spring assembly is a critical component that provides the lifting force for the door. Carefully mount the spring assembly above the opening, following the manufacturer’s instructions. This step often requires specialized tools and expertise, as the springs are under significant tension.
Step 5 Attach the Curtain to the Spring Assembly
Connect the top of the curtain to the spring assembly. This may involve attaching the curtain to a roller or drum that is connected to the spring mechanism. Ensure the connection is secure and properly aligned.
Step 6 Test the Door Operation
Carefully test the door’s operation by manually lifting and lowering it. The door should move smoothly and evenly without binding or sticking. Adjust the spring tension as needed to achieve proper balance.
Step 7 Install the Motor (If Applicable)
If your roll-up door is motorized, install the motor unit according to the manufacturer’s instructions. This typically involves mounting the motor to the spring assembly and connecting it to the electrical wiring. Ensure all electrical connections are secure and properly grounded.
Step 8 Install Safety Features
Install any safety features, such as photo eyes or safety edges, to prevent the door from closing on obstructions. Test these features to ensure they are functioning correctly.
Safety Notes
Safety is paramount when installing a roll-up garage door. Always wear safety glasses and gloves to protect yourself from injury. Use proper lifting techniques to avoid back strain. If you’re working with electrical wiring, disconnect the power supply before starting. Troubleshooting Common Issues
Even with careful installation, you may encounter some common issues. Here are a few troubleshooting tips:
- Door is difficult to open or close: Adjust the spring tension or lubricate the tracks and rollers.
- Door is uneven or binding: Check the alignment of the tracks and adjust as needed.
- Motor is not working: Check the power supply, wiring connections, and motor settings.
